Groovy 2.2.0

groovy.lang
[Java] Class GroovyClassLoader.InnerLoader

java.lang.Object
  java.lang.ClassLoader
      java.security.SecureClassLoader
          java.net.URLClassLoader
              groovy.lang.GroovyClassLoader
                  groovy.lang.GroovyClassLoader.InnerLoader

public static class GroovyClassLoader.InnerLoader
extends GroovyClassLoader

Field Summary
 
Fields inherited from class GroovyClassLoader
classCache, sourceCache
 
Constructor Summary
GroovyClassLoader.InnerLoader(GroovyClassLoader delegate)

 
Method Summary
void addClasspath(String path)

void addURL(URL url)

void clearCache()

URL findResource(String name)

Enumeration findResources(String name)

Class[] getLoadedClasses()

URL getResource(String name)

InputStream getResourceAsStream(String name)

GroovyResourceLoader getResourceLoader()

long getTimeStamp()

URL[] getURLs()

Class loadClass(String name, boolean lookupScriptFiles, boolean preferClassOverScript, boolean resolve)

Class parseClass(GroovyCodeSource codeSource, boolean shouldCache)

void setResourceLoader(GroovyResourceLoader resourceLoader)

 
Methods inherited from class GroovyClassLoader
addClasspath, addURL, clearCache, createCollector, createCompilationUnit, defineClass, defineClass, generateScriptName, getClassCacheEntry, getClassPath, getLoadedClasses, getPermissions, getResourceLoader, getTimeStamp, isRecompilable, isShouldRecompile, isSourceNewer, loadClass, loadClass, loadClass, loadClass, parseClass, parseClass, parseClass, parseClass, parseClass, parseClass, recompile, removeClassCacheEntry, setClassCacheEntry, setResourceLoader, setShouldRecompile
 
Methods inherited from class URLClassLoader
getResourceAsStream, newInstance, newInstance, findResource, findResources, close, getURLs, loadClass, getSystemClassLoader, getResource, getSystemResource, getSystemResourceAsStream, clearAssertionStatus, getParent, getResources, getSystemResources, setClassAssertionStatus, setDefaultAssertionStatus, setPackageAssertionStatus, wait, wait, wait, equals, toString, hashCode, getClass, notify, notifyAll
 

Constructor Detail

GroovyClassLoader.InnerLoader

public GroovyClassLoader.InnerLoader(GroovyClassLoader delegate)


 
Method Detail

addClasspath

public void addClasspath(String path)


addURL

public void addURL(URL url)


clearCache

public void clearCache()


findResource

public URL findResource(String name)


findResources

public Enumeration findResources(String name)


getLoadedClasses

public Class[] getLoadedClasses()


getResource

public URL getResource(String name)


getResourceAsStream

public InputStream getResourceAsStream(String name)


getResourceLoader

public GroovyResourceLoader getResourceLoader()


getTimeStamp

public long getTimeStamp()


getURLs

public URL[] getURLs()


loadClass

public Class loadClass(String name, boolean lookupScriptFiles, boolean preferClassOverScript, boolean resolve)


parseClass

public Class parseClass(GroovyCodeSource codeSource, boolean shouldCache)


setResourceLoader

public void setResourceLoader(GroovyResourceLoader resourceLoader)


 

Copyright © 2003-2013 The Codehaus. All rights reserved.